BPI-M3 - manual build using mainline u-boot and kernel

Last time I have tried to build u-boot for M3 SMP support in u-boot was missing. Kernel 4.10.x boots, basic things works, but you only got one cpu core. https://github.com/igorpecovnik/lib WIP section.
